However, longer pubic hair, also meant the potential for pubic lice, which could only be completely eliminated by shaving or removing the hair in another way, such as with homemade dilapidory creams.

Those wanting to create the illusion of pubic hair, could put together a merkin ~ a pubic hair wig, first designed in 1450.
The malkin, or merkin, was made from hair, that was attached to the pubic area with a pretty, dainty ribbon.

While douching first appeared in the ancient world, the Tudors avoided it, believing it was unnecessary.
